Yes, exactly that. snapShootDetails on ReplicationHandler is a plain volatile field that is never cleared -- getReplicationDetails publishes it under backup whenever it is non-null. It gets overwritten by the next backup, or by a snapshot deletion, and it is only back to null after a core reload or node restart, at which point the backup key is simply absent again.

That lifetime is pre-existing and this PR does not change it. What it changes is when the first overwrite lands: it used to be at the end of the next backup, so a stale success survived the entire run of the backup that was meant to replace it. Now it is replaced the moment the next backup is requested, which is the part that fixes the stale read.

You prompted me to go look at the docs, and my checklist claim was wrong: backup-restore.adoc -- "Backup Status" does document the shape of this response, it just only showed the completed success payload. I have pushed a ref-guide commit that adds the two in-progress statuses and states this retention behaviour explicitly, so a reader knows a success may describe an earlier backup rather than one just requested.

Yes -- Solr has a family of "record what the code published, then assert on the collected sequence" helpers rather than racing the thing under test. The three closest to this one:

  • TrackingBackupRepository (solr/test-framework/src/java/org/apache/solr/core/TrackingBackupRepository.java) is the nearest, and it is in this same feature area: it wraps the repository and records every copyIndexFileFrom / createOutput / createDirectory into a synchronized list so a test can assert on what a backup actually did. AbstractIncrementalBackupTest asserts on copiedFiles() / outputsCreated() / directoriesCreated(), as do LocalFSCloudIncrementalBackupTest and the S3/GCS/HDFS backup tests. Same seam as here -- the per-file copy inside a running backup -- and the same shape.
  • SoftAutoCommitTest.MockEventListener registers a SolrEventListener that offers each async commit / newSearcher event into a LinkedBlockingQueue, and the test asserts on the ordering of what arrived. That is the precedent for asserting on an asynchronous sequence rather than polling for a single state.
  • SnapshotBackupAPITest.TrackingSnapshotBackupAPI overrides doSnapShoot and records what the handler passed instead of running a live backup -- the same seam this test uses. The Consumer<NamedList<?>> overload of ReplicationHandler.doSnapShoot is what ReplicationHandler itself calls, so this is not a test-only backdoor.

The alternative would have been BackupStatusChecker, which polls command=details over HTTP (TestRestoreCore, TestReplicationHandlerBackup, TestStressThreadBackup). I did not use it because it is deliberately terminal-state-only -- it returns null for anything that is not success -- and its own javadoc says it is "NOT suitable/safe ... because the replication handler API provides no reliable way to check the results of a specific backup before the results of another backup may overwrite them internally". Polling it for an intermediate status would flake: on a test-sized index the copy loop can finish between two 50ms polls.

Worth recording that the new statuses do not disturb that helper either -- non-success statuses still return null, and neither the exception check nor the startsWith("Unable to delete") check can match waiting for commit / running.

=== Backup Status

The `backup` operation can be monitored to see if it has completed by sending the `details` command to the `/replication` handler, as in this example:
The `backup` operation can be monitored by sending the `details` command to the `/replication` handler, as in this example:

.Status API Example
[source,text]
----
http://localhost:8983/solr/gettingstarted/replication?command=details&wt=xml
----

.Output Snippet
The `backup` section of the response describes the most recent backup on the core, whether it is still running or has already finished.
While a backup is in progress, `status` is one of:

`waiting for commit`::
The backup has been requested, but its index commit -- and with it the list of files to copy -- has not been resolved yet.
No file counts are reported.

`running`::
The backup's files are being copied.
`fileCount` is the total number of files to copy, and `finishedFileCount` how many of them have been copied so far.

.Output Snippet: a running backup
[source,xml]
----
<lst name="backup">
<str name="startTime">2022-02-11T17:19:33.271461700Z</str>
<str name="status">running</str>
<str name="snapshotName">my_backup</str>
<str name="directoryName">snapshot.my_backup</str>
<int name="fileCount">10</int>
<int name="finishedFileCount">4</int>
</lst>
----

`snapshotName` is only reported for a named backup.

Once the backup completes, `status` becomes `success`:

If it failed then an `exception` will be sent in the response.

The reported status is retained until the next backup is started on the core, or until the core is reloaded.
A `success` may therefore describe an earlier backup rather than one that was just requested; a newly requested backup replaces it with `waiting for commit` as soon as it is accepted.
